Transaction 224bdbe85e106a2e93a93d712840f32e54189af726f463aa0ec9fb7f5b87fa3c

1 Input
2 Outputs
  • 224bdbe85e106a2e93a93d712840f32e54189af726f463aa0ec9fb7f5b87fa3c:0
  • value  388820
    address  33cMbd4AtZpUhWDGbmRYfs9jAU9be9LqUH
  • 224bdbe85e106a2e93a93d712840f32e54189af726f463aa0ec9fb7f5b87fa3c:1
  • value  5528781
    address  1JQQM2H2EMWJWg3Jh1X2KvE1yk21z25HX7